Fermentation: Definition, Process & Applications
Fermentation is a metabolic process that produces chemical changes in organic substrates through the action of enzymes. In biochemistry, it is narrowly defined as the process in which glucose is broken down anaerobically.
The term fermentation has been used to refer to a wider variety of processes for thousands of years. In the latter part of the 19th century, the science of bacteriology began to distinguish fermentation from putrefaction, a similar process in which organic matter decomposes to form foul-smelling products as a result of bacterial growth.
Today, the term fermentation is used to describe the process in which yeasts and bacteria convert sugars into alcohol or acids. It is also used to describe the metabolic processes that occur in muscles when deprived of oxygen, as in strenuous exercise.
In the food industry, fermentation is used to produce a wide variety of products, including beer, wine, cheese, yogurt, and bread. It is also used to produce some industrial products, such as biofuels and solvents.
